導航:首頁 > 編程語言 > pjsipdtmf

pjsipdtmf

發布時間:2023-02-03 18:37:48

『壹』 pjsip 嵌入式 必須有系統

想把pjsip移植到嵌入式Linux下,該設備有多個fxs/fxo埠,每個埠對應一個dsp通道。pjsip目前只是對音效卡類設備進行支持,實現的pjsua也僅僅對一個音效卡設備支持,並不支持多埠。

在移植中,可以考慮如下方法:

1、把每個fxs/fxo埠對應的dsp通道適配成一個音效卡設備,對pjsua改造,呼叫的時候,指定使用哪一個音頻設備

方法好處就是完全支持pjmedia現有的媒體框架,基本不改動原有流程和代碼

pjsip庫升級時,原有自己實現的設備不受影響

2、在pjsip代碼中進行攔截,攔截收發報文時決定使用的那個通道

該方法修改了pjsip流程,在以後pjsip庫需要升級時,需要同步修改

3、把整個dsp適配成一個音效卡設備,擴展參數,來通知dsp使用哪個通道

該方法同樣要修改pjsip代碼,對以後升級不利

因此,最好的方法,就是把dsp的每個通道適配成一個音頻設備,混音功能同樣適配成mix設備。

pjsip目前還不支持特性 收藏

1、sip info方式dtmf接收

2、call waiting

3、t38傳真

4、t30傳真

5、digitmap

6、call parking

這些在pjsip的簡單的uaapp中都沒有,需要自己實現。可以使用pjsip-ua,pjsip lib自己實現ua或者在現有ua上進行擴充。

閱讀全文

與pjsipdtmf相關的資料

熱點內容
ipodwatch如何安裝app 瀏覽:114
誰有微信搶紅包的群號 瀏覽:872
word07頁碼從任意頁開始 瀏覽:791
js禁止滑動事件 瀏覽:800
蘋果查序號怎麼看不是 瀏覽:61
linux在txt文件 瀏覽:568
ps如何導入文件匹配 瀏覽:201
轉轉app怎麼把自己的賬號租出去 瀏覽:828
福昕閱讀器合並照片pdf文件 瀏覽:591
vhd文件有什麼用 瀏覽:482
編程小朋友看什麼書 瀏覽:623
經營如何讓數據說話 瀏覽:258
如何在手機上升級opop 瀏覽:614
coreldrawx5免費視頻教程 瀏覽:725
網站引導頁面源碼 瀏覽:234
個人簡歷範文word 瀏覽:220
uc下載的視頻怎樣提取到文件 瀏覽:499
英雄下載下載最新版本2015下載安裝 瀏覽:433
NX深孔鑽編程替換面如何操作 瀏覽:725
手機怎麼刪除pdf文件 瀏覽:256

友情鏈接